Leonardo da Vinci

Painter of the Mona Lisa; apprenticed under Verrocchio; worked for patrons like Ludovico Sforza and Francis I; died in France at 66.

2
New cards

Lisa Gherardini

The woman in the painting; married silk merchant Francesco del Giocondo at 15; sat for Leonardo around 1503; never got the finished portrait; died in a convent.

3
New cards

Vincenzo Perugia

Stole the Mona Lisa in 1911; was a glazier who'd worked on the Louvre's protective glass; hid the painting for 2+ years; claimed patriotic motives; caught trying to sell it in Florence.

4
New cards

Alphonse Bertillon

Famous criminologist; found the thief's thumbprint on the display glass but failed to match it to Perugia; also known for wrongly convicting Alfred Dreyfus.

Francesco del Giocondo

Lisa's husband; wealthy silk merchant; commissioned the portrait.

6
New cards

Louis Béroud

Painter who discovered the Mona Lisa was missing and pushed for an investigation.

7
New cards

Louis Lépine

Paris police chief who led the massive (and largely unsuccessful) investigation.

8
New cards

Théophile Homolle

Louvre director who'd bragged the painting couldn't be stolen; fired after the theft.

9
New cards

Pablo Picasso

Bought stolen Louvre statues from Géry Pieret; got swept into the Mona Lisa investigation and denied knowing his friend Apollinaire.

10
New cards

Guillaume Apollinaire

Poet, Picasso's close friend; briefly arrested as a suspect for possessing stolen Louvre items.

11
New cards

Alfredo Geri

Florentine art dealer Perugia contacted to sell the painting; helped recover it.

12
New cards

Giovanni Poggi

Uffizi director who authenticated the recovered painting.

13
New cards

Andrea del Verrocchio

Leonardo's teacher in Florence.

14
New cards

Ludovico Sforza

Duke of Milan; Leonardo's patron for ~20 years.

15
New cards

Francis I

French king; Leonardo's final patron; supposedly at his deathbed.

16
New cards

Géry Pieret

Small-time thief who stole Louvre statues and sold some to Picasso.

17
New cards

Eduardo de Valfierno

FICTIONAL "mastermind" from a false, popular news story
